I bumped into this one tonight.
I have a generic war component used in multiple projects. The various projects
need to replace its deployment descriptor when they consume it, but the
replacement is skipped whenever the core project changes the default deployment
descriptor.
I have to imagine that this is a pretty common usage for large J2EE projects.
(unzip, copy, zip) or (copy, touch, zip) are viable workarounds, but add
needless complexity.
